exfds.c sample program

The exfds.c demonstrates how an Open Server application can service external file descriptors without blocking the entire Open Server process. This program:

The two service threads implement a simple command/response protocol by writing messages on the UNIX pipes. srv_poll allows Open Server to reschedule the service thread while waiting for a message. Information is written to srv.log to monitor the progress. The Open Server performs the command/response protocol the number of times specified in the source code, then queues a SRV_STOP event.

This sample does not require a client application. Check the srv.log file for messages to determine if it has started correctly.
